Claim Handling Quality Engineer (m/f/d) We Elevate... Your Best Self We are seeking a results-driven, detail-oriented professional with strong analytical and communication skills, who thrives in both independent and team settings, demonstrates entrepreneurial leadership, and brings enthusiasm and commitment to fostering a quality-driven culture in an international environment.
Minimum qualifications:
Degree in Quality Management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or similar qualification
At least 3 years of industrial experience, with a solid understanding of manufacturing processes and quality management tools such as PPAP, PFMEA, Quality Audits, 8D, 5S, Lean Manufacturing, Six Sigma
Minimum 2 years of hands-on experience with diverse manufacturing techniques, especially related to metal fabrication and/or the machine manufacturing industry
Good project management experience, with the ability to drive cross-functional initiatives
Strong working knowledge of ISO 9001 standards and their practical implementation
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office suite and knowledge of SAP QM
Proficient in German and English
